Kazakhstan ready to be mediator in mending relations between West and Islamic world - Bobrov
Deputy Chairman of the Kazakh Majilis Vladimir Bobrov has said at a roundtable entitled "The Strategy of the EU in Central Asia and new Agreement between the Republic of Kazakhstan and EU on enhanced partnership".
The Kazakh parliamentarian reminded that this year our country chairs the OIC. "I am confident that Kazakhstan's experience in the OSCE will be useful in the OIC and give it "a new breath," he said.
V.Bobrov noted, that in the light of the current events in North Africa and the Middle East, Kazakhstan faces a serious task on rendering assistance on stabilizing the situation in the region and support of the countries in the transition period, using the mechanisms and institutions of the Organization.
"Taking into account active participation of our European partners in the process of stabilization and rendering assistance to these countries, Kazakhstan is ready to be a mediator in the issue regarding mending of relations between the West and the Muslim world through the current regional structures. It will allow to create additional conditions for formation of a constructive dialogue between the two largest civilizations of the world," V.Bobrov emphasized.
